Воспользуемся формулой разности квадратов: \( a^2 - b^2 = (a - b)(a + b) \).
\( (61 - 39)(61 + 39) = 22 \cdot 100 = 2200 \)
\( (45 - 55)(45 + 55) = (-10) \cdot 100 = -1000 \)
\( (13,6 - 3,6)(13,6 + 3,6) = 10 \cdot 17,2 = 172 \)
\( (5,8 - 94,2)(5,8 + 94,2) = (-88,4) \cdot 100 = -8840 \)
\( \left(\frac{8}{5}\right)^2 - \left(\frac{2}{5}\right)^2 = \left(\frac{8}{5} - \frac{2}{5}\right)\left(\frac{8}{5} + \frac{2}{5}\right) = \left(\frac{6}{5}\right)\left(\frac{10}{5}\right) = \frac{6}{5} \cdot 2 = \frac{12}{5} = 2,4 \)
\( \left(3\frac{5}{8}\right)^2 - \left(1\frac{3}{8}\right)^2 = \left(\frac{29}{8}\right)^2 - \left(\frac{11}{8}\right)^2 = \left(\frac{29}{8} - \frac{11}{8}\right)\left(\frac{29}{8} + \frac{11}{8}\right) = \left(\frac{18}{8}\right)\left(\frac{40}{8}\right) = \frac{9}{4} \cdot 5 = \frac{45}{4} = 11,25 \)
Ответ: а) 2200; б) -1000; в) 172; г) -8840; д) 2,4; е) 11,25.
